Effective Team Communication Tools
As the world continues to shift towards distributed work environments, remote work are becoming increasingly common. While technology has provided numerous tools to facilitate communication and collaboration, some teams are turning to a familiar app: WhatsApp. Yes, the popular messaging platform that started as a personal messaging service is now being used by businesses to manage teams. But is WhatsApp a suitable tool for team collaboration, and what are the benefits and limitations of using it for work purposes?

Advantages of WhatsApp for Remote Team Collaboration

1 WhatsApp is free to use, making it an attractive option for startups that are operating on a tight budget. You don't need to spend money on pricey collaboration software, which can be a significant cost savings.
2 WhatsApp is widely used, and most people have a personal account already. This eliminates the need to onboard new team members onto a specific collaboration tool.
3 WhatsApp has a user-friendly interface that is easy to navigate, even for those who are not tech-savvy. This makes it an excellent choice for teams that need to collaborate with people from diverse technical backgrounds.
4 WhatsApp allows for smooth video conferencing, making it an excellent tool for remote meetings and whatsapp网页版 discussions. You can also share files, images, and other content with your team members.
5 Integrations with other apps are also available, which enables you to connect your workflow and easily automate tasks.

Disadvantages of Using WhatsApp for Team Collaboration


1 While WhatsApp is free, there are limitations to the number of users you can add to a group chat. This can be a challenge for larger teams, or teams that need to manage multiple groups.
2 WhatsApp's built-in features may not be sufficient to meet the complex needs of a large team. You may need to use third-party apps to get the features you need, which can be confusing and create more work.
3 Information can get lost in the feed. Without a proper organization system, it can be difficult to find specific information or conversations in a large group chat.

Best Practices for Using WhatsApp for Team Collaboration


1 Establish clear communication rules: To avoid confusion, set ground rules for how you will use WhatsApp for work purposes.
2 Create separate groups: You can create separate groups for different projects or teams, making it easier to find conversations.
3 Use profiles: Encourage team members to use their real names or a business profile to avoid confusion.
4 Communicate work boundaries: Communicate that WhatsApp is for work purposes only and that your personal account is separate.

In conclusion, WhatsApp can be a useful tool for team collaboration, especially for small teams that need to keep costs low. However, for big teams, a dedicated collaboration platform may be a better option. Ultimately, the choice between using WhatsApp or a specific collaboration platform will depend on the team's needs and preferences.
